Introduction to the Disaster
The recent severe flooding in Limpopo has left a trail of destruction and devastation in its wake. The region, which received an unprecedented 580mm of rain in just four days, has been severely impacted, with infrastructure destroyed and lives lost. The flooding has been described as one of the worst in recent history, with the sheer scale of the disaster leaving many in shock. The community has been left to pick up the pieces and come to terms with the extent of the damage, with many homes and buildings destroyed or severely damaged.

Causes of the Flooding
The causes of the flooding are complex and multifaceted. The region’s geography, with its steep slopes and poor drainage, makes it prone to flooding. However, the unusually high amount of rainfall in such a short period of time was the main contributing factor to the severity of the flooding. Climate change has also been cited as a potential factor, with many experts warning that extreme weather events like this will become more frequent and intense in the future. The region’s infrastructure, which is often inadequate and poorly maintained, also played a role in the severity of the flooding. The disaster has highlighted the need for improved disaster management and infrastructure in the region, to mitigate the impact of future flooding events.
